The DIGITbrain approach has combined the physical and digital dimensions during the whole industrial product lifecycle, making use of advanced data collection and analysis techniques, including models, algorithms, and resources to empower manufacturing providers with an adaptive capacity to optimise the behaviour and performance of the instances of industrial products, by considering the individual context and operating conditions, enabling manufacturing providers to offer their solutions as a service, guaranteeing optimal operation and workload.
The participation of DIHs facilitated widespread coverage to engage the manufacturing community, thus boosting the adoption of the Db Solution. DIGITbrain has converted the CloudiFacturing Solution and ecosystem towards the requirements of MaaS, utilising the Digital Brain and its underlying technology components as the project’s main innovation.
DIGITbrain realises an ambitious technological vision by developing the Digital Brain concept and its enabling technologies. It assures that these technological advances are taken up by a critical mass in the manufacturing sector, especially by SMEs and mid-caps, resulting in the smart business model MaaS, facilitated by a network of interconnected DIHs.
DIGITbrain unleashes novel and smart business models by combining two main innovations: the Digital Brain concept in which the whole lifecycle of an Industrial Product, both from a physical and a digital perspective, is captured, and the creation of local efficient value networks by matching supply and demand of advanced manufacturing technologies.
DIGITbrain benefits not only manufacturing SMEs and mid-caps but also technology providers, DIHs, and, in general, the EU population that will benefit from advanced manufacturing solutions. Moreover, DIGITbrain contributes to improving the EU manufacturing performance, reducing delivery times and thus customer satisfaction, while better control of manufacturing processes and the efficient use of resources to foster sustainable design and more eco-friendly Industrial Products.
Finally, the implementation of the ambitious and ground-breaking Db concept is generating breakthrough knowledge, resulting in 22 scientific publications so far.
